Dojrzałość matematyczna w przedszkolu - kluczem do sukcesu
Start date: Jul 1, 2016, End date: Jun 30, 2018 PROJECT  FINISHED 

„Mathematic maturity in preschool – the key to success” project was created to guarantee optimal intellectual development for children in mathematics. After carrying out few researches we’ve diagnosed that out pupils get lower scores in mathematics education than in other fields. That is why we want to participate in series of training courses in Finland and Cyprus so we could upgrade our skills. Aims:- Upgrading teacher’s professional competences during European courses, gaining practical skills to teach mathematics effectively. IT and language skills perfection.- Developing creative and innovative methods which would help us to equip children in necessary knowledge and skills letting them succeed with learning.- Teaching parents so they could introduce to their children the interesting world of mathematics in an active and effective way.All our teachers are involved in this project because we want to ensure the optimal effects of the project achievements. The teachers have a perennial seniority, they are highly qualified and have an experience in European cooperation. Actions description:- Specify the priorities in teaching mathematics basing on the results of mathematic diagnosis. Teaching children through emotions and practical actions during diverse operations. Internalize knowledge through regularity of actions.- Schedule the tasks and aims for „Mathematic maturity in preschool – the key to success” project for years 2016 – 2018.- The project sets up a combination of functional teaching with diverse forms of cognitive activity. It will happen through children independent experiences engaging mind and emotions.- Establishing cooperation with training centers in Finland (Structured Study Visit to Schools/Institutes & Training Seminar) and Cyprus (The new method of using mathematics communication activities for improving the teaching and learning of mathematic).- Self-perfecting, using best practice and increasing the virtual mobility.- Workshop enrichment, studying practical solutions used in Finland and Cyprus.- Continuing the cooperation with an internet platform “Edukacja na nowo”.- Systematic monitoring of project aims realization (survey for parents, lesson control card and mathematic skills maturity diagnosis).- Project popularization – workshops for teachers, letting out a brochure with lesson scripts, organizing mathematic feast, Internet publications.Expected results:- Teachers have practical skills for organizing math classes in creative and innovative way.- Deploy the effective methods of teaching mathematics used in European countries. - Raised motivation for developing foreign language skills.- Our own work effects and European countries experience comparison.- Well trained teaching staff will become the foundation for teaching children in a creative way and to inspire parents in terms of teaching mathematics.- Children will gain specified mathematic knowledge and skills resource which will help them to start school education.Project impact:- Teaching staff: get to know and deploy in their work the European countries experience.- Kindergarteners: through fun and experimenting they will gain skills which will help them in the future with daily life and school education.- Our pupils’ parents: will get familiar with many interesting forms of mathematic games and support their children in developing mathematic abilities.Taking part in the project is also a chance for getting to know the habits and the cultural variety of European countries, as well as it is a way to build European community by cognizing games together and cultivating creativity and imagination.Our preschool, as a facility which introduces innovative work methods, is creating, supporting and establishing their own positive image as a preschool dutiful about needs of its’ pupils and using modern forms of education.
